Types of support available
In Springdale, survivors can access a variety of support services, including:
- Lawyers: Legal professionals who specialize in domestic violence cases can provide you with the necessary guidance and support.
- Therapists: Mental health professionals are available to help you process your experiences and work towards recovery.
- Shelters: Safe havens are offered for those who need immediate refuge from abusive situations.
- Hotlines: Confidential hotlines provide 24/7 support and resources for survivors seeking assistance.
- Legal Aid: Organizations can assist with legal paperwork and representation if you cannot afford a private attorney.
Legal protections overview
Understanding your legal rights is crucial. In Springdale, various protections are available for survivors of domestic violence. These may include restraining orders, custody arrangements, and more, depending on the specifics of your situation. It is advisable to consult with a legal professional who can guide you through the process based on your individual circumstances.
Safety planning basics
Creating a safety plan is an important step for anyone experiencing domestic violence. This plan should include strategies for staying safe in your home, ways to reach out for help, and a list of important contacts. Consider identifying safe places to go in an emergency, packing a bag with essentials, and having a code word with trusted friends or family members to signal when you need help.
